The highly anticipated animated film, "Puss in Boots: The Last Wish," hit theaters in December 2022, captivating audiences with its stunning visuals, charming storyline, and the return of the beloved feline character, Puss in Boots. However, the film's success was soon marred by a wave of piracy, with many fans turning to illicit streaming sites to watch the movie for free.
